[FFmpeg-devel] VP8 sliced threading

Michael Niedermayer michaelni at gmx.at
Tue Jul 17 16:42:11 CEST 2012


On Mon, Jul 16, 2012 at 09:47:16AM +0200, Reimar Döffinger wrote:
> On 16 Jul 2012, at 02:01, Michael Niedermayer <michaelni at gmx.at> wrote:
> > On Wed, Jul 11, 2012 at 11:26:14PM -0400, Daniel Kang wrote:
> >> My implementation no longer uses sched_yield().
> > 
> > patches applied by luca and merged by me
> 
> And thus we accumulate more buggy threading code that will randomly fail and make helgrind cry.
> Please someone at least mark the synchronization variables used outside a locked area as volatile.

i posted 2 patches that i hope should address this issue

[...]
-- 
Michael     GnuPG fingerprint: 9FF2128B147EF6730BADF133611EC787040B0FAB

While the State exists there can be no freedom; when there is freedom there
will be no State. -- Vladimir Lenin
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 198 bytes
Desc: Digital signature
URL: <http://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20120717/8129b7f2/attachment.asc>


More information about the ffmpeg-devel mailing list